1) Is Soulja Boy actually broke? Maybe, maybe not. I have absolutely no knowledge of Soulja Boy's actual finances, but we can still easily use the young man as an example of how complicated hip-hop finance can be, a world where the line between "money" and "real money" can get pretty damn blurry. For example: your a young rapper and your label gives you a million dollar advance on an album. That is an advance, aka money you have to pay back. In other words, you're simultaneously a millionaire and a million dollars in debt. Now you decide to spend all your new found cash on huge chains and the nicest cars, but when the landlord asks for 10 grand for rent, you just don't have it - even though you've got hundreds of thousands in the bank, you owe all that money to your label. Is that what happened here? I have no idea, but I do know that it happens everyday to young men who just don't know how to handle those kinds of high-level finances.
